FOR COURT USE ONLY ATTORNEY FOR (NAME) SUPERIOR COURT OF CALIFORNIA, COUNTY OF El Dorado STREET ADDRESS: MAILING ADDRESS: CITY AND ZIP CODE: PETITIONER/PLAINTIFF: RESPONDENT/DEFENDANT: CASE NUMBER: DECLARATION NOTICE UPON EX-PARTE APPLICATION FOR ORDERS Pursuant to California Rule of Court 3.1203, notice of the ex-parte application should be given no later than 10:00 a.m. the court date before the ex parte appearance, absent a showing of exceptional circumstances that justify a shorter time for notice. NOTICE WAS NOT GIVEN: Notice was not given of the hearing for the following reason indicated: Notice of the application would frustrate the purpose of the orders and the applicant would suffer immediate and irreparable harm if the adverse party learns that this order is being sought before it is entered. - OR The following reasonable and good faith efforts were made to notify the adverse party and further efforts to give notice would probably be futile or unduly burdensome. 6. Explain in Detail why no notice was given: The undersigned attorney/party understands that emergency ex-parte hearings are available for actions filed pursuant to the Family Law Act, Domestic Violence Act and the Uniform Parentage Act only where an actual urgency exists. If actual facts in support of a finding of an emergency do not exist, sanctions may be imposed.
